Health Surveillance of Legionnaires' Disease in the Normandy Region. 2019 Report.
Key Points
In 2019, 48 cases residing in Normandy were reported
A return to an annual number similar to that of 2015–2017, as in mainland France, following the increase in cases in 2018
A regional incidence rate that remains among the lowest in mainland France
Case characteristics identical to those observed at the national level
90% of patients had a risk factor
The proportion of cases in which a strain was isolated remained stable.
